core: Implement LB Delay Observability (Proposal A121) (#12807)

This PR implements **Attempt-Level RPC Delay Observability** across the core channel transport, built-in load balancers, xDS policies, and the OpenTelemetry telemetry plugin, aligned with [gRPC Proposal A121](https://github.com/grpc/proposal/pull/556).
